Airports in London
London Heathrow Airport (LHR)
London Heathrow Airport (LHR) to the centre of London takes about 45 minutes by car. The centre is roughly 24 kilometres away.
Getting there on public transport typically takes 25 minutes.

London Gatwick Airport (LGW)
After your flight from Porto Airport to London has hit the runway, you can reach the city centre in around 1 hour 5 minutes by car. Central London is roughly 48 kilometres from London Gatwick Airport (LGW).
If you're travelling on public transport, it'll take around 1 hour 20 minutes.

London Stansted Airport (STN)
London Stansted Airport (STN) is about 56 kilometres from central London. It'll take you about 1 hour 5 minutes to reach the city centre in a ride-share or taxi after your flight from Porto Airport to London.
If you use public transport, expect a journey of around 45 minutes.

Best time to go to London
January is the quietest month for flights from Porto Airport to London, while July is the busiest. Pick the best time to visit London based on whether you prefer a laid-back vibe or a lively atmosphere.
Before locking in your Porto Airport to London plane ticket, think about the kind of weather forecast you're hoping for. July is the warmest month in London, with temperatures ranging from 11ºC to 26ºC.
January has average temperatures of between 0ºC and 9ºC. Look for a cheap ticket from OPO to London around that time if you like travelling in cooler conditions.
